*Craving Comfort? Try Cajun Creamy Tuscan Fish with Rice & Roasted Broccoli!* πŸ˜‹πŸšπŸ₯¦

A deliciously rich and creamy Cajun-inspired dish that’s sure to satisfy your cravings!

*Ingredients:*

*For the Fish:*

– 2 white fish fillets (tilapia, cod, or catfish)

– 1 tbsp olive oil

– 1 tbsp butter

– 1 tsp Cajun seasoning

– Β½ tsp garlic powder

– Β½ tsp smoked paprika

– Β½ tsp salt

– Β½ tsp black pepper

*For the Creamy Tuscan Sauce:*

– 1 tbsp butter

– 3 cloves garlic, minced

– Β½ cup heavy cream

– ΒΌ cup Parmesan cheese, grated

– Β½ tsp Cajun seasoning

– 1 cup fresh spinach

– ΒΌ c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ped

*For the Rice & Roasted Broccoli:*

– 1 cup white rice, cooked

– 2 cups broccoli florets

– 1 tbsp olive oil

– Β½ tsp garlic powder

– Β½ tsp salt

– Β½ tsp black pepper

*Directions:*

*1️⃣ Cook the Rice:* Follow the instructions on the rice package and set it aside once done.

*2️⃣ Roast the Broccoli:* Preheat your oven to 400Β°F (200Β°C). Toss the broccoli florets with olive oil,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Roast for 15-20 minutes until tender and slightly crispy.

*3️⃣ Prepare the Fish:*

Pat the fish fillets dry and season them with Cajun seasoning,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Heat olive oil and butter in a sk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the fish for 3-4 minutes per side until golden brown and flaky. Remove the fish from the skillet and set aside.

*4️⃣ Make the Creamy Tuscan Sauce:* In the same skillet, melt butter and sautΓ© minced garlic for about 30 seconds. Stir in he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, and Cajun seasoning. Add the spinach and sun-dried tomatoes, cooking until the sauce thickens. Let it simmer for 2 minutes, then pour the creamy sauce over the fish.

*5️⃣ Plate & Serve:* Serve the fish over a bed of cooked white rice and spoon extra creamy Tuscan sauce on top. Serve with roasted broccoli on the side.*Enjoy your rich, comforting Cajun-inspired meal!

* 😍*⏳ Prep Time:* 10 minutes *🍳 Cook Time:* 25 minutes *⏱️ Total Time:* 35 minutes *Calories:* ~600 per serving *Protein:* ~45g per serving
